Repeating myself

Deborah Schultz posted her Top Ten Community Marketing Phrases She Finds Herself Repeating Over and Over.

Here are mine…

  1. Try to explain that to me in a way that your mother would understand it.
  2. English Cut worked because he’s a rockstar. You’re not a rockstar.
  3. The problem with corporate blogs is the damn things won’t write themselves.
  4. If I understand MySpace at 42, why don’t you twenty-somethings understand it?
  5. This stuff (social media) isn’t supposed to be complicated.
  6. There, that was painless, wasn’t it?
  7. Yes his blog is read by only 2,000 people but it’s probably the 2,000 people you most want to reach.
  8. Call all of your friends who have blogs and get them to write about it and link to it too.
  9. They said nice things about you on the backchannel. Really.
  10. You’re allowed to comment on other people’s blogs you know.
